Hebrew-English Dictionary
Strongs: H8337
Hebrew: שֵׁשׁ
Transliteration: shêsh
Pronunciation: shaysh
Part of Speech: Noun
Bible Usage: six ({[-teen} {-teenth]}) sixth.
Definition:
a primitive number; six (as an overplus (see H7797) beyond five or the fingers of the hand); as ordinal sixth
1. six
a. six (cardinal number)
b. sixth (ordinal number)
c. in combination with other numbers
